Shuttle-Bus Gate — Contractor Guidance

The shuttle between Dunmore Plaza and the Hartle Ridge campus departs from Gate C on the service road, not the main forecourt. Contractors should arrive at least five minutes before the scheduled run, as the driver cannot wait once the barrier cycle begins. Hi-vis is required beyond the gate line at all times. The pedestrian turnstile beside Gate C is keypad-controlled and is the only approved entry point for contractors; to pass through, enter the code below.

staff pass of kawip-hawef = bdg-QLP-2

Leadership Review Briefing — Training Budget

Proposed next-year training budget for Ostrel Dynamics rises 8%, concentrated on the Kellway certification track and manager onboarding. Legacy e-learning contracts with Bramforth Institute will lapse. Each department receives a fixed allocation; unused funds return centrally at mid-year. Priya Nallam will circulate allocation sheets next week. One budget line remains restricted, and it is noted confidentially below.

internal memo for hahif-hahaf: Headcount on the Zorwyn team goes from 9 to 100 by the end of October. Gross margin on Zorwyn came in at 5 percent against a plan of 10 percent.

Leadership Review Briefing — Project Hollowpine

For branch managers' eyes only: we're in early talks to acquire Fernwick Tooling, a regional fabricator that would plug our capacity gap in the Ashmere corridor. Diligence starts next week; keep staffing questions parked until then. Nothing goes to your teams yet. The confidential note on our plans appears below.

board note of bawep-tajef: Queniusek Systems plans to raise the Quenvan list price by 53.1 percent in March. The pricing group signed off on a budget of $176.4 million for Project Drueth. The renewal with Casionix Partners closes at $142.5 million a year, 8.3 percent below the last contract. Project Fraax slips by six weeks because of the tooling delay.